Abstract
The nonlinear dynamics of a DNA chain on the Peyrard-Bishop-Dauxois (PBD) model is investigated. It is shown that the DNA dynamics can be described by the modified Ablowitz-Ladik (MAL) equation. The Ricarti method is applied and we derive an exact solution of the MAL equation when a recurrence relation is established. Thereafter, the evolution of the found solution as well as the impact of elasticity are carried out in the PBD system with realistic values of parameters.
